The ID of the Status Packet is 127 (decimal).
Frame Info Valid. Set when a valid frame info word has been received since becoming synchronous to
the system and the f and c fields contain valid values. If this bit is clear, no valid frame info words have
been received since the KS8701 became synchronous to the system. This value will change from 0 to
1 at the end of block 0 of the frame in which the 1st frame info word was properly received. It will be
cleared when the KS8701 goes into asynchronous mode. This bit is initialized to 0 when the KS8701 is
reset and when the KS8701 is turned off by clearing the ON bit in the Control Packet.
